iRobot Roomba 570
Roombas run on rechargeable nickel-metal hydride batteries that require regular recharge from a power adapter. Most newer models have a home base that can be automatically returned to and connect to for charging. The home base can also function as an invisible barrier that blocks the robot out of certain areas.
The earlier models have to be informed of the size of the room but later models can estimate it by using the longest straight-line path they can travel without hitting an obstacle. They may also use dirt detection to determine the cleanliness of a space.
Certain models come with an accessory called a Scheduler that allows the owner to program the robot to start cleaning at specific times. A dongle known as OSMO connects to the robot's serial port to upgrade it to version 2.1 software. This fix a bug that could cause a Roomba to perform an "circle-dance" during a cleaning session.
